Transaction 21f6fc4f041463e23423f2fe41482a26ca9c6e63352b720151015433803c6ce2

2 Input
2 Outputs
  • 21f6fc4f041463e23423f2fe41482a26ca9c6e63352b720151015433803c6ce2:0
  • value  1000000
    address  1DQgVQVjo3zBvMdu3N693NzNGAVi8rVVRw
  • 21f6fc4f041463e23423f2fe41482a26ca9c6e63352b720151015433803c6ce2:1
  • value  9258862
    address  35x2BpQgDcJ29Z8Tf8wkvjCkVkFBszDhGD